Output e30157af081749da194f373d9a6a1b7f3938ee4840f1837df9f43d65f9519bc5:14

value
23043088
script pubkey
OP_0 OP_PUSHBYTES_20 4d285a6c4ee67054ba0da342ffebe53893dbc326
address
bc1qf5595mzwuec9fwsd5dp0l6l98zfahsexsz3kvm
transaction
e30157af081749da194f373d9a6a1b7f3938ee4840f1837df9f43d65f9519bc5